completions: property_completer improvements

This commit is contained in:
z00000000z 2023-08-23 16:21:37 +00:00 committed by James Westman
parent 582502c1b4
commit bcac788456
15 changed files with 76 additions and 33 deletions

View file

@ -80,6 +80,7 @@ class Completion:
kind: CompletionItemKind
signature: T.Optional[str] = None
deprecated: bool = False
sort_text: T.Optional[str] = None
docs: T.Optional[str] = None
text: T.Optional[str] = None
snippet: T.Optional[str] = None
@ -103,6 +104,7 @@ class Completion:
if self.docs
else None,
"deprecated": self.deprecated,
"sortText": self.sort_text,
"insertText": insert_text,
"insertTextFormat": insert_text_format,
}